The Natural Lands Trust is a nonprofit land conservation organization dedicated to protecting the forests, fields, streams, and wetlands of Eastern Pennsylvania and Southern New Jersey. It has more than 21,000 acres of nature reserves. Over the weekend, volunteers were preparing trust land for the storm. Pictured are volunteers at Crow’s Nest Preserve in Chester County getting trees and shrubs planted (photo: Daniel Barringer). Digging at this site was difficult due to rocks and roots, but the group persevered.
